Based on the local analysis Toomre (1981) proposed the swing amplification mechanism in which the self-gravity forms spiral arms as leading waves of stars rotate to trailing ones due to galactic shear. The structure of spiral arms is characterized by their number and pitch angle. We perform global $N$-body simulations of spiral galaxies to investigate the dependence of the spiral structure on disk parameters and compare the simulation results with the swing amplification model.
